the mean composite score for seniors who took the sat in 2018 was 1068. if the standard deviation for this same year was 180, what is the raw score for a person with a z score of –0.42?
A person with a Z-score of -0.42 would have a raw score of 992.4 on the SAT taken in 2018.
The standard deviation is a measure of how much the data varies from the mean. A Z-score is a standardized value that represents the number of standard deviations a raw score is from the mean.
To find the raw score given a Z-score, we can use the following formula:
raw score = mean + Z-score * standard deviation
For the mean composite score of 1068 and a standard deviation of 180, we can plug in the values for the Z-score of -0.42:
raw score = 1068 + (-0.42) * 180
raw score = 1068 - 75.6
raw score = 992.4
Note: The Z-score of -0.42 indicates that the raw score is 0.42 standard deviations below the mean.

\(3x(5x^2-6x+3)\)if the number of degrees of freedom for a chi-square distribution is 25, what is the standard deviation? round to four decimal places. standard deviation
The standard deviation for a chi square distribution for given degree of freedom is 7.0711.
The chi-square distribution is parameterized by the number of degrees of freedom (df). As the number of degrees of freedom increases, the shape of the distribution becomes more symmetrical and approaches a normal distribution.
The standard deviation (σ) of a chi-square distribution with k degrees of freedom is given by the formula:
σ = sqrt(2k)
Therefore, for a chi-square distribution with 25 degrees of freedom:
σ = sqrt(2(25)) = sqrt(50) ≈ 7.0711
Rounding this to four decimal places gives a standard deviation of approximately 7.0711.

if there are 5 finalists at a singing competition, in how many ways can they be ordered, if they each take turns singing?
If there are 5 finalists at a singing competition, in 120 ways they can be ordered, if they each take turns singing by applying basic counting principles.
There are 5 finalists at a singing competition and each of them takes turns singing.
We can calculate the number of ways the 5 finalists can take up turn by applying basic counting principles.
Therefore, they can be ordered in n factorial ways, that is n !, where n is the number of finalists who take turns to sing.
Thus, number of ways the finalists can be ordered is = 5!
= 5*4*3*2*1 ( ways )
= 120 ways
